Download Rails 4 Application Development HOTSHOT by Saurabh Bhatia PDF

By Saurabh Bhatia

Rails is a speedily relocating, open resource, net improvement framework, and maintaining to hurry with it's a tremendous job. you will have already equipped purposes utilizing it, yet there were major adjustments within the syntax and semantic of the Rails framework within the most recent upgrade.

Rails four program improvement Hotshot exhibits you the way to construct the preferred different types of purposes utilizing Rails four, and highlights new how you can do issues. The ebook additionally heavily follows most of the most sensible practices, gemstones, and well known recommendations already recognized to the neighborhood, and tracks the adjustments in those. This e-book brings new principles to refactor and restructure code to make it practice larger in construction, and helps you to write production-ready code.

Show description

By Saurabh Bhatia

Rails is a speedily relocating, open resource, net improvement framework, and maintaining to hurry with it's a tremendous job. you will have already equipped purposes utilizing it, yet there were major adjustments within the syntax and semantic of the Rails framework within the most recent upgrade.

Rails four program improvement Hotshot exhibits you the way to construct the preferred different types of purposes utilizing Rails four, and highlights new how you can do issues. The ebook additionally heavily follows most of the most sensible practices, gemstones, and well known recommendations already recognized to the neighborhood, and tracks the adjustments in those. This e-book brings new principles to refactor and restructure code to make it practice larger in construction, and helps you to write production-ready code.

Show description

Read Online or Download Rails 4 Application Development HOTSHOT PDF

Similar web development books

Foundation Version Control for Web Developers

Beginning model regulate for internet builders explains how model regulate works, what you are able to do with it and the way. utilizing a pleasant and available tone, you are going to use the 3 top model regulate systems—Subversion, Git and Mercurial—on a number of working platforms. The background and quintessential recommendations of model keep an eye on are coated so you will achieve a radical realizing of the topic, and why it may be used to control all adjustments in internet improvement initiatives.

Professional Website Performance: Optimizing the Front-End and Back-End

Achieve optimum web site pace and function with this Wrox guide
Effective web site improvement calls for optimal functionality in regards to either net browser and server. This publication covers all points of creating and preserving web content that convey height functionality on all degrees. Exploring either front-end and back-end configuration, it examines components like compression and JavaScript, database functionality, MySQL tuning, NoSQL choices, load-balancing throughout a number of servers, potent caching of internet contents, CSS, and masses extra. either builders and method directors will locate price during this platform-neutral consultant. * Covers crucial info for developing and keeping web content that carry top functionality on either entrance finish and again finish* Explains how you can configure front-end functionality regarding the internet browser and the way to hurry up communique among server and browser* issues comprise MySQL tuning, NoSQL choices, CSS, JavaScript, and internet photos* Explores the right way to reduce the functionality consequences of SSL; load-balancing throughout a number of servers with Apache, Nginx, and MySQL; and powerful caching and compression of net contents
Professional site functionality: Optimizing front finish and again finish bargains crucial details to aid either front-end and back-end technicians be sure greater web site performance.

Sass for Web Designers

Foreword through Chris Coyier.

Let's face it: CSS is tough. Our stylesheets are extra advanced than they was once, and we're bending the spec to do up to it may well. Can Sass help?

A reluctant convert to Sass, Dan Cederholm stocks how he came over to the preferred CSS pre-processor, and offers a uncomplicated route to taking larger regulate of your code (all the whereas operating how you regularly have). From getting began to complex concepts, Dan may help you point up your stylesheets and immediately commence making the most of the facility of Sass.

Contents: - Why Sass? - Sass Workflow - utilizing Sass - Sass and Media Queries. - Dan Cederholm is a dressmaker, writer, and speaker dwelling in Salem, Massachusetts. He's the Co-Founder of Dribbble, a neighborhood for designers, and founding father of SimpleBits, a tiny layout studio. A long-time suggest of standards-based website design, Dan has labored with YouTube, Microsoft, Google, MTV, ESPN and others. He's written a number of well known books approximately website design, and obtained a TechFellow award in early 2012. He's presently an aspiring clawhammer banjoist and sometimes wears a baseball cap.

Web Development with Django Cookbook (2nd Edition)

Over 70 functional recnonfiction, programming, net improvement, djangoipes to create multilingual, responsive, and scalable web pages with Django

About This booklet
• increase your talents via constructing versions, varieties, perspectives, and templates
• Create a wealthy consumer event utilizing Ajax and different JavaScript ideas
• a realistic advisor to writing and utilizing APIs to import or export info

Who This publication Is For
If you may have created web content with Django, yet you need to sharpen your wisdom and examine a few stable techniques for a way to regard varied elements of internet improvement, be sure to learn this publication. it truly is meant for intermediate Django clients who have to construct tasks which needs to be multilingual, sensible on units of alternative reveal sizes, and which scale through the years.

What you'll examine
• Configure your Django venture the correct manner
• construct a database constitution out of reusable version mixins
• deal with hierarchical buildings with MPTT
• Play properly with JavaScript in responsive templates
• Create convenient template filters and tags so that you can reuse in each undertaking
• grasp the configuration of contributed management
• expand Django CMS together with your personal performance

In aspect
Django is straightforward to profit and solves every kind of net improvement difficulties and questions, supplying Python builders a simple strategy to web-application improvement. With a wealth of third-party modules on hand, you'll manage to create a hugely customizable internet software with this strong framework.

Web improvement with Django Cookbook will advisor you thru all internet improvement procedures with the Django framework. you'll get all started with the digital setting and configuration of the venture, after which you'll easy methods to outline a database constitution with reusable parts. how to tweak the management to make the web site editors chuffed. This booklet offers with a few vital third-party modules worthy for absolutely outfitted net improvement.

Additional resources for Rails 4 Application Development HOTSHOT

Sample text

0). ) Smashing eBook #29│Designing For Android│ 35 The final graphic assets would appear like this using the four different screen densities. Smashing eBook #29│Designing For Android│ 36 After you’ve produced all of your graphics, you could organize your graphics library as follows: The suggested organization and labeling of asset folders and files. In preparing our star graphic, all file prefixes could be preceded by the name ic_star, without changing the names of the respective densities. Smashing eBook #29│Designing For Android│ 37 You might be confused about what PPI (pixels per inch) to set your deliverables at.

Aside from transitions, animations are a great way to keep users distracted or entertained when the app needs to make them wait. Smashing eBook #29│Designing For Android│ 62 User Experience Android has patterns and conventions like any other platform. These help users to form expectations about how an unfamiliar app will behave. Porting an iOS experience directly to the Android platform almost always results in a poor user experience. Back is a platform affordance in Android. In contrast, labeled back buttons within the app layout are the norm for iOS.

6. Go back to the opened Android SDK folder on your desktop, and open the “Tools” folder. 7. Click on the file ddms to open the Dalvik Debug Monitor. 8. Select your device from the “Name” pane. 9. In the application’s top menu, open the “Device” menu, and choose “Screen capture…” A Device Screen Capture window will open, and you should see the launch screen of your Android device. Smashing eBook #29│Designing For Android│ 49 The Dalvik Debut Monitor. To navigate: 1. Grab your Android device and navigate to any page.

Download PDF sample

Rated 4.39 of 5 – based on 29 votes